Like any first-timer, Kobie Brown recounted how a director called him out on the set

RJ MataroBy RJ MataroMarch 31, 2023No Comments2 Mins Read
Facebook Twitter Pinterest Reddit Telegram LinkedIn Tumblr VKontakte WhatsApp Email
Share
Facebook Twitter Reddit Pinterest Email

The Kapamilya artist Kobie Brown recounts on March 22, how he got called out by a director on the set while working on one of his previous projects.

At the set visit for Teen Clash in Quezon City, Brown admitted he encountered challenges with his first acting project after exiting the Pinoy Big Brother house.

“Oo dati, basta po parang– okay I think, so this happened sa isang project, I think sobrang late na at nakalimutan ko ‘yung mga blockings ko, ‘yung mga lines ko. Kasi bago ako, bago ako sa acting, sa industry and I remember the director coming in and I got called out because it was super late na.”

He then noted that his experience made him commit to improving himself with his future projects.

“I was getting pressured, and we we’re running out of time na, parang cut off namin ay 2:30, and I felt like– kasi sobrang over thinker ako talaga. Especially before, and I felt like I was wasting everyone’s time, but after that, I made sure na gagalingan ko sa next role ko.”

He then clarified that he learned from the director he worked with in his previous project.

“And ever since I worked with that director, and I love him so much, si Direk Manny, I love you talaga. I learned so much from that guy, and kahit super serious siya, he’s [an amazing] director– and he knows what he wants. So ayun maraming salamat direk Manny, I learned so much.”

Brown worked with the director Manny Palo in the series Love in 40 Days (2022).

As for his latest series, Brown joins Teen Clash, starring Jayda Avanzado, Aljon Mendoza, and Markus Paterson.

The cast also features Bianca de Vera, Zach Castañeda, Fana, Luke Alford, Andi Abaya, Ralph Malibunas, and Gail Banawis.

Under the direction of Gino M. Santos and the production of Blacksheep, catch every episode of Teen Clash on iWantTFC every Friday at 8 pm.
